Pokémon Go Tour: Sinnoh - Path Selection Issue Raises Concerns for L.A. Event

Pokémon Go players are facing yet another issue that is affecting the path selection for certain Special Research options in the upcoming Go Tour: Sinnoh event. This problem has left players concerned about the smooth running of the event.

Pokémon Go Tour: Sinnoh - Path Selection Issue Raises Concerns for L.A. Event

Go Tour: Sinnoh – Los Angeles

Niantic has split the Go Tour: Sinnoh event into an in-person and global section, similar to previous iterations. The physical portion of the event, Go Tour: Sinnoh – Los Angeles, is scheduled to begin on Feb. 17 and has already sold out. Thousands of players from around the world will gather at the Rose Bowl Stadium for a weekend of Pokémon Go fun, provided that the issues are resolved.

Learning from Past Failures

Niantic has acknowledged the problems faced during the Go Tour: Hoenn event in 2023, including connectivity issues and features not working properly. The company has assured players that it has learned from these past failures and aims to provide a great experience for all trainers during Go Tour: Sinnoh – L.A. However, the current Special Research issue is causing doubts among players.

Path Selection Problem

Niantic has identified a problem where the path selection for Special Research may not proceed smoothly. This issue arose when the Go Tour 2024: Road to Sinnoh Special Research went live, prompting players to choose between Diamond or Pearl version paths for the event. Some players have reported being unable to select the Pearl version. Since this is a significant part of Go Tour: Sinnoh's content, it is concerning that it is not functioning properly at the start of the event.

Potential Resolution

As Go Tour: Sinnoh – L.A. does not officially begin until Feb. 17, there is a possibility that Niantic will be able to fix the pathing problem before it becomes a major issue. However, this ongoing trend of bugged content affecting events has raised concerns among players, with some expressing worries about the upcoming L.A. event being plagued by bugs.
